In Ingglish — phonetic English where every spelling always makes the same sound — the word “scriptwriters” is spelled “skriptraiterz”. Here is how it sounds out, one sound at a time:
| Ingglish | s | k | r | i | p | t | r | ai | t | er | z |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| IPA | /s/ | /k/ | /ɹ/ | /ɪ/ | /p/ | /t/ | /ɹ/ | /aɪ/ | /t/ | /ɝ/ | /z/ |
English writes “scriptwriters” with
13 letters for 11 sounds. Ingglish writes it
“skriptraiterz” — no silent letters, and the same spelling
always makes the same sound, so you can read it exactly as it looks.
